5.1.1 Two Force Membersīefore we discuss the structure of trusses, we must begin with defining two force members:Ī two force member is a body that has forces (and only forces, no moments) acting on it in only two locations. ![]() Method of sections is more like a rigid body analysis where you can also include the moment equilibrium equation. Method of joints is more like a particle analysis wherein you use only x and y equilibrium equations. A “gable end” refers to the entire wall, including the gable (triangle portion of the wall) and the wall below it. Your roof “rake” is essentially the measurement of the sloped sides of a gable end.
